What is a concrete Batching plant?

Anyone in the construction industry knows the importance of concrete. That's why this composite material is used to build skyscrapers, sidewalks and bridges, houses and driveways, highways, and many other things around the world. After setting and forming, concrete is strong enough to resist some of the greatest natural forces as a durable material. However, concrete is "plastic" in that it can be molded and shaped into almost any shape before it hardens. When it hardens, the quality of concrete depends on its properties as a mixture.

A mixture, you say?

It is! Concrete does not form on its own and needs to be procured by applying a specific process to its various components. The process involves getting the proportions of water and cement, sand and gravel just right so that a durable concrete product can be created. In fact, if the mixture contains a little excess paste or water, the resulting concrete foundation is prone to cracking - instead, rough concrete is produced from a concrete mixture that does not contain enough paste or water mixture. Obviously, no ordinary mixing techniques can be used here, so specific equipment is required.

Ready-mixed Concrete Batching Plant

A Ready-mixed Concrete Batching Plant is a concrete plant designed for the production of commercial ready-mixed concrete. It is generally located in urban areas and transports ready-mixed concrete for projects via concrete mixer trucks. Compared to engineering concrete batch plants, commercial concrete batch plants have higher requirements for durability, reliability, safety and environmental friendliness of concrete batch plant systems.
